When you choose a quality commercial or industrial advertising photographer, you're investing in a professional who brings expertise, creativity, and technical precision to the table. Here's what you can expect from the experience: 1. Understanding Your Brand: A quality photographer will take the time to understand your brand, your industry, and your advertising goals. They'll grasp your unique selling points and tailor their approach to showcase your products or services in the best possible light. 2. Concept Development: Collaborating with you, the photographer will develop creative concepts that align with your advertising objectives. They'll brainstorm ideas, plan compositions, and consider lighting techniques that amplify your brand's message. 3. Technical Excellence: Quality commercial and industrial photographers possess technical mastery. They're skilled in handling various lighting scenarios, camera settings, and equipment to capture images that are sharp, well-exposed, and visually appealing. 4. Attention to Detail: These photographers have a meticulous eye for detail. From product shots to industrial landscapes, they ensure that every element is in place, from composition to background to props, creating a polished and professional look. 5. Problem Solving: Challenges often arise during commercial and industrial shoots, whether it's lighting constraints or intricate setups. A quality photographer excels in finding solutions on the spot, ensuring the shoot progresses smoothly. 6. Versatility: Whether it's studio product photography or on-site industrial shoots, a quality photographer is versatile. They can adapt their skills to various environments and scenarios, producing consistently excellent results. 7. Collaboration: They view the process as a partnership. Your input is valued, and they'll work closely with you to achieve your vision. They'll provide guidance while also embracing your ideas and feedback. 8. Post-Production Expertise: The work doesn't end with the photoshoot. Quality photographers have solid post- production skills, ensuring that your images are enhanced, retouched if needed, and optimized for your chosen platforms. 9. Deliverables: You can expect a range of high-quality deliverables. These may include edited images in various formats, ready for use in your advertising campaigns, websites, brochures, and other promotional materials. 10. Bringing Your Vision to Life: Ultimately, a quality commercial or industrial advertising photographer translates your vision into compelling visuals. They use their artistic prowess and technical finesse to create images that resonate with your target audience and convey your brand's essence. In summary, a quality commercial or industrial advertising photographer offers a seamless blend of creativity, technical skill, and collaboration. They’ll take the time to understand your needs, transform ideas into captivating images, and provide you with assets that elevate your advertising efforts.
